The Malpassuti Inn is located in the ancient centre of Carbonara Scrivia, just a few steps from the 13th c. fortress given by Baron Guidobono Cavalchini Garolfi to the municipality.
After five kilometres on the road from Tortona, you reach the Inn surrounded by a gentle hilly countryside.
The manor-house dating back to the end of the 18th c. belonged to the poet Malpassuti. Today, it has been restored and modified to become a Restaurant, with a wonderful garden with century-old trees, where meetings and congresses can be held.
In summer, it’s a pleasure to have lunch in the open air garden, while in winter the food is served in little rooms heated by the fireplace and decorated with antique furniture. In autumn, this Inn is the best place for gourmets to eat mushrooms and white truffles, while black truffles are available through the rest of the year.
The Marenzana Family is the owner and manager of the Inn.. Together with the cook Carluccio, they keep a long cooking tradition, based on traditional recipes, but serving a large variety of delicious menus.
Food and wine is personally served by Marinella, creating a welcoming atmosphere to make you feel totally home.
A pleasant extra can often be found under the antique "portico": vintage cars, belonging to the owner.
Crossing Valle Ossona, at about 8 kilometers, you can visit the Castellania Mausoleum, the birth home of Fausto e Serse Coppi, great cycling champions.
